What is the Difference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have features which make them useful for different types of occupations.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job place and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They often have open tops and a door on the front. That makes it easy for workers to load a wide selection of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the earth. The arms tilt to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This is a useful option for companies that collect large am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are typically left on place,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. That makes it feasible for sterilization professionals to remove garbage and trash for multiple homes and companies in the region at affordable prices.
Planning Ahead for Your Dumpster Rental in Moss
Planning ahead for your dumpster service in Moss will make your project easier and safer to conclude on time. When renting a dumpster in Moss, follow these suggestions to help you plan ahead.
1. Clear an area that's large enough for the dumpster to sit down for a number of days or weeks. Additionally, make sure that you and other folks have access to the dumpster. You should have a clear path that prevents accidents.
2. Prepare the things you need to remove. In the event you're cleaning out a waterlogged basement, for instance, try to remove as much of the damaged stuff before the dumpster arrives.
3. Get any permits you may desire. If your plan is to leave the dumpster on a public street, then you certainly might want permission from the city.
4. Have your safety equipment ready. This includes gloves, back supports, and other things which you will need to dispose of your debris when the dumpster arrives.

Rubbish removal vs dumpster service in Moss - Which is right for you?
When you have a job you're going to undertake at home, you might be wondering if it is better to hire someone to come haul off all your garbage and junk for you, or in case you need to just rent a dumpster in Moss and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better solution in case you'd like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you don't mind doing it yourself to save on labour. Dumpsters also function well in case you've at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Roll offs usually start at 10 cubic yards, thus if you just have 3-4 yards of waste, you're paying for much more dumpster than you want.
Trash or junk removal makes more sense in case you'd like someone else to load your old stuff. In addition, it works well if you'd like it to be taken away fast so it is outside of your own hair or in case you only have a few big items; this is probably cheaper than renting a whole dumpster.
Some Things That You Can't Put into Your Dumpster
Although the particular rules that control what you can and cannot include in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several kinds of substances that most dumpster service service in Mosss WOn't permit. A number of the things which you normally cannot put in the dumpster include:
Batteries, particularly the kind that include m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other substances that can damage the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ially the ones that comprise batteries There are also some mattresses you could generally put in your dumpster so long as you are willing to pay an additional f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it's best to get in touch with your rental business to get a list of things that you can not place into the dumpster.

When will my dumpster get picked up?
You may normally schedule the quantity of time you plan to keep the dumpster when you first phone to set up your dumpster service. This typically contains the drop-off and pickup dates. Most companies do request that you be present when the dumpster is delivered. This really is necessary to make sure the dumpster is put in the top place for your project. You don't have to be present when the dumpster is picked up to haul it away.
Should you get into your job and understand you need pickup sooner or later than you initially requested, that's no problem. Just phone the business 's office and describe exactly what you require, and they will do everything they can to accommodate your request. There may be times they cannot meet your adjusted program precisely due to previous commitments, nevertheless they will do the best they can to pick your dumpster upward at the appropriate time.

10 yard dumpster measurements in Moss
A 10 yard dumpster is constructed to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although exact container sizes will change with different firms.
It can be hard to select just the container size you'll need for your home job, but a 10 yard dumpster functions well for smaller cleaning jobs.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:
-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ck that has been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a small k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is large enough that you don't have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but small enough that you don't need an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should work flawlessly.
Do I require a license to rent a dumpster in Moss?
If this is your first time renting a dumpster in Moss, you may not know what's leg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. Should you plan to put the dumpster totally on your own property, you're not typically required to acquire a license.
If, however, your job needs you to place the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this will under normal conditions mean you have to try to qualify for a license. It's almost always wise to consult your local city or county offices (possibly the parking enforcement department) in case you have a question concerning the demand for a license on a road.
Should you don't get a license and discover out later that you were required to have one, you will likely face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ster service in Moss c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.
